Are “Exempt” pesticides required to be registered in Florida?

0

Yes. Pesticide products classified as “exempt” under FIFRA Section 25(b) of the Federal Pesticide Law must be registered in Florida. Please request a copy of Florida’s written policy on the registration of “exempt” pesticides. The policy is also available on the website of the Florida Department of Agriculture & Consumer Services/Division of Agricultural Environmental Services/Bureau of Pesticides (http://www.flaes.org/pesticide/pesticideregistration.html).
